LLS Posted April 29, 2005 Share Posted April 29, 2005 Most of the time it is the switch, however i have seen the wire age inside the gromet from where the door is repeatedly opened and closed.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
rayikone Posted April 29, 2005 Share Posted April 29, 2005 I had the same problem. First I bought a brand new switch, no help. Then I got the wiring diagram and shot the wires. Found a bad ground, so I jumped it and everything worked fine. That worked for about six months then the window failed again. I wound up taking it to the dealer and they replaced the driver's side harness.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
